The color #7259B7 is a blue that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 114, 89, 183 and HSL values of 256°, 39%, 53%.

Complementary Colors for #7259B7
The complementary color for #7259B7 is #9DB658.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#7259B7
These are the darker variations of #7259B7.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#5B4792 and #44356E. This progression shows how #7259B7 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
